Mobile gaming generally falls into three categories. Native applications are installed directly from official digital storefronts or an operator’s homepage. Instant-play platforms run entirely through a standard web browser, requiring no installation. Finally, Progressive Web Apps (PWAs) bridge the gap by creating a lightweight desktop shortcut powered by web technology.
These portable solutions have quickly surpassed traditional desktop setups for most Kiwi players. Integrated features like real-time push alerts, biometric security (such as Face ID), and mobile-exclusive promotions offer superior convenience, while responsive touch interfaces make spinning slots or placing table bets highly intuitive.

Casino App vs Mobile Browser
The best casino apps, including both Apple and Android apps, as well as web browser platforms, provide access to gambling. However, there are several important differences that players should be aware of before they get started with real money gaming activities.
| Feature | NZ Casino Apps | Mobile Browser |
|---|---|---|
| Installation | Download required | No download required |
| Performance | Fast and sleek | Depends on browser and connection |
| Push Notifications | Available | Not available |
| Storage Space | Uses device storage | No downloads |
| Bonuses | Some mobile casino bonus options | Same as desktop |
| Updates | Require updates | No downloads |
| Accessibility | Launch from home screen | Through browser |
| Security | Can use biometrics | Password based |
Native real money gambling apps are often the preferred choice for players who value speed and convenience, or who log in regularly enough for the download to be worthwhile. Browser-based casinos suit occasional players or anyone who just wants to test a platform before committing.

Crash Games & Casino Originals
Crash titles challenge players to cash out before a multiplier loses its value and ‘crashes’. The most popular example of this is Aviator. Crash games, inspired by stock-trading mechanics, reward quick decision-making.
Casino originals include wheel-based games, instant-win titles and other experiences specifically for online play. These are worth exploring if you’re looking for something different or with shorter cycle times.

Responsible Gambling on Casino Apps
Mobile devices make casino games more accessible than ever, but responsible gambling is just as important. Casino operators include a variety of tools designed to help players with responsible gambling. Setting limits and recognising warning signs can help ensure that gambling remains an enjoyable form of entertainment. Here are some of the main responsible gambling tools at your disposal:
- Self-exclusion: Allows players to block access to their accounts across a whole network of legal sites.
- Deposit and time limits: Enable players to restrict how much money or time they spend within the app, or at least to set reminders.
- Support: Provide access to professional support organisations such as GamCare, Gamblers Anonymous, and GambleAware. They may also offer educational materials to help.
